Depends on what your goals or objectives are. I'd start by making a plan or list the qualities and features I would need or prefer after the buildup is completed. And remember, changing one component or system may impact performance/reliability of another. It's nice to have a high HP motor but it won't do much if the trans or rear diff are weak points, destined to break apart...

To answer your question on what $20K will buy you, I'd visit one of the forum vendor sites and let your imagination and mouse do the rest, keeping in mind the plan. Maryland Speed, HHP, Shop Hemi (Arrington) and Modern Muscle sites will give you an idea of what costs what.

For labor costs, I'd call around to several local shops and ask them what their rates are and how much it would cost to install the performance widget.
